Type
ORACLE
Validation date
2024-10-21 05:19: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01419,
    "usd": 0.01542
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001AAE849CB643AEE66533B08092C21A3C1754152F7014980C11453D9D71E800BB9

Previous signature

1F40E2AD901BB3EC325A0B21470A88E94409887C810074A6C3D8056165670847E011B9D22BB61DC32DF5D5A62A9202F2FF8F71211FBF024E96C5F337DBFC2D01

Origin signature

3043021F348586DCE8387B7D43075DA03428122B3D49D882F4F08A634A5E43696FCD150220614D80EC53640EE4786CB96007F13BF8472576149E43627A8DE13CB95C05B41B

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

00CF4720F07CB28B92FAB8113731FB82AA1BCA3B81C03CE6E82B4B65B80822AB79

Coordinator signature

59FD36B2393922C35A0387B6E5625CB4BEA62EB05663BEB1F1170FFE234BE27E08F60DF61F2B906B615BA6C311B8C185150A0D03E7A45926D2E7E55D0BEFCF01

Validator #1 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#1 signature

ED0F10FABBCA0A3B9979ADA6C10F58AA0BBA008EE02F2F303B700DCD753616205EC2FD95CE24970966960DA6DE62A950CC1BABF0BBE49032118659EF5A003E09

Validator #2 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#2 signature

28E78166067EF93E3694D3C4E410500AC5817558221409002AE49300FB8AD5C65B43602016B3B42DD0B7052A7F6B25D537EA3BD072A59452309F695D01015B01